如何正确下载和安装Ceph-base以及其相关的依赖包?
时间: 2024-10-23 16:08:47 浏览: 18
ceph-mgr-dashboard-14.2.7-0.el7.noarch.rpm
5星 · 资源好评率100%
安装Ceph-base和其相关依赖通常需要遵循Linux系统上的标准包管理步骤。下面是针对Debian/Ubuntu和CentOS/RHEL系统的简要指南:
**对于Debian/Ubuntu系统:**
1. 更新系统:
```
sudo apt-get update
sudo apt-get upgrade
```
2. 安装必要的工具包(如Git、build-essential等):
```
sudo apt-get install git curl software-properties-common dpkg-apt-repository ppa:ceph/keys
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 042F082D
```
4. 安装Ceph-base:
```
sudo apt-get install ceph-common
```
5. 配置并启动Ceph集群(如果有需要):
- 完成Ceph配置文件(如`ceph.conf`)
- 运行安装向导 `sudo ceph-deploy new mon.0 osd.0`
**对于CentOS/RHEL系统:**
1. 更新系统:
```
sudo yum update -y
```
2. 安装必要的工具包(如Git, epel-release,-devel工具):
```
sudo yum groupinstall "Development Tools"
sudo yum install epel-release
```
3. 添加EPEL仓库(额外软件源):
```
sudo yum-config-manager --enable epel
```
4. 安装Ceph及其依赖:
```
sudo yum install ceph-mds ceph-mon ceph-osd
```
5. 配置并启动Ceph服务:
- 启动并设置开机自启:
```
sudo systemctl start ceph-mon ceph-mds ceph-osd
sudo systemctl enable ceph-mon ceph-mds ceph-osd
```
安装完成后,确认Ceph服务运行正常,并根据实际需求配置存储池和客户端操作。
阅读全文